Tracking AI vendor terms is becoming a real business-opportunity category because teams are no longer just choosing a model on quality alone; they are depending on external AI providers for core product workflows, and those providers can change usage limits, retention rules, geographic access, identity requirements, and policy exceptions with little warning.

That creates a new operational problem: legal and procurement teams may approve one set of terms, while developers and product teams are already shipping against a different reality. The pain shows up in several concrete ways.

First, companies can lose access or see degraded service when a vendor changes policy, raises prices, or restricts certain use cases, which can interrupt customer-facing features and internal automation. Second, teams often do not have a reliable way to compare retention and data-routing terms across vendors, so they cannot easily tell whether a model is safe for regulated workflows or sensitive prompts.

Third, many organizations discover too late that a model is unavailable in certain regions, requires a different identity or account setup, or has a hidden exception that breaks a planned deployment. Fourth, once a team is locked into one provider’s API, prompts, workflows, and audits become hard to move, which increases strategic dependence and makes exit planning expensive.
